The coordinates of the vertices of a polygon are (0,3), (2,3) (2,0), (1,-4) and (-2,-1). What is the perimeter of the polygon to the nearest tenth of a unit?

A. 15.8 units

B. 16.9 units

C. 17.8 units

D. 18.6 units

Option C. 17.8 " units"

Explanation:

As shown in th figure, ABCDE is the polygon.
perimeter of the polygon p=AB+BC+CD+DE+EA
As AB is a horizontal line, => AB=|2-0|=2
As BC is a vertical line, => BC=|0-3|=3
Use the distance formula to find CD,DE and EA
CD=sqrt((1-2)^2+(-4-0)^2)=sqrt(1+16)=sqrt17
DE=sqrt((-2-1)^2+(-1-(-4))^2)=sqrt(9+9)=sqrt18
EA=sqrt((0-(-2))^2+(3-(-1))^2)=sqrt(4+16)=sqrt20

=> perimeter p=2+3+sqrt17+sqrt18+sqrt20~~17.8 units
